44% Riesling, 39.5% Gewürztraminer, 14.5% Pinot Blanc and 2% Muscat. All the varietals were fermented in stainless steel tanks and then blended together to make the perfect flavor profile. In the end, 2% of Muscat was added to help deliver the more flowery notes on the nose. This wine is a great balance of acidity and sweetness and it is very easy to drink. May get aromas of exotic fruits, white lily and green apples. Pairs nicely with BC coast cuisine.

Tasting notes written by Tony Aspler.
Geographical Indication: BC VQA Okanagan Valley
Varietal: Riesling (44%), Gewürztraminer (39.5%), Pinot Blanc (14.5%), Muscat (2%)
Vineyard: Various Naramata Bench & Oliver vineyards
Residual Sugar: 5.3 g/L
Cases Produced: 920
Appearance: Pale straw in colour.
Nose: Spicy, aromatic nose of lychee, lemon zest, and grapefruit.
Palate: Medium-bodied, just off-dry with good tension between the honeyed grapefruit flavour, the muscat’s grapey-floral note, and the spine of acidity from the riesling. Sustains well on the palate.
Quality: 90 points. Outstanding. Drink now.
Food Pairing: Golden beet carpaccio, lemongrass pork with vermicelli noodles, halibut with grapefruit beurre blanc, smoked trout with horseradish cream, and apricot and brie bruschetta.
